  2. Not only is Roy Batty on the roof of the Advocet hotel, there is an origami bird left on the reception table on the ground floor of the hotel. This is another Blade Runner reference because the character Gaff leaves origami animals lying around in the film.

  3. There are interactions with the main story if you unlock the Blackwall SMG or Cyberdeck. Some specific main story points will prompt the Blackwall to speak to you, as well as things to do with Rache Bartmoss and Alt Cunningham.

  4. Now that you mentioned Far Cry 3, I noticed something interesting. The pistol 'Rook' you get from Voodoo treasure, its Chinese translated name is literally Far Cry, I guess it is referring to the 'Rook' Island of Far Cry 3
